1st - CH Otterbobs Tolson (Mr J R & Mrs H Gilpin)
Red Grizzle 5yrs old, super head, great expression, clean narrow front, stood on well boned legs and feet, good lay of shoulder and return of upper arm, lovely neck excellent top line, correct tail set but being very picky would like his tail a little straighter, well ribbed up, with a good underline, well muscled loin, with excellent quarters, easy to span, moved true fore and aft, held his shape in profile CC & BOB.
2nd - CH Yorkpiece Fiery Lucifer (Mrs J L Lee)
Blue/Tan dog, a very smart workmanlike dog, very good head & muzzle, narrow front, nice body length, good jacket, thick pelt, just carrying too much white in his coat for me, excellent quarters, moved soundly
